据RZNews.com10月27日奥斯陆报道,挪威石油和能源部日前在奥斯陆宣布,挪威和俄罗斯已经签署了一项关于在巴伦支海进行地震数据采集的共同权利的协议。
根据挪威石油和能源部刊登在其官方网站上的一份声明,新协议将使双方的地震船都有权越过巴伦支海地区的分界线并在对方距大陆架3英里的范围内使用其地震设备。
挪威石油和能源大臣Kjell-Borge Freiberg在一份政府声明中说:“这项新协议是2010年9月签署划界协议后的自然后续行动,这项新协议届时将使两国受益。”
挪威石油和能源大臣补充说:“这意味着两国将更有可能把到分界线和沿分界线的资源潜力绘制成地图。”

Norway and Russia Sign Seismic Deal
Norway and Russia have signed an agreement The new agreement will entail a right for seismic vessels from both parties to cross the delimitation line in the region and use their seismic equipment within a distance of three miles “The agreement is a natural follow-up of the signing of the delimitation agreement in September 2010 and will benefit both countries,” the Norwegian Minister of Petroleum and Energy, Kjell-Borge Freiberg, said in a government statement.
“It entails a better possibility for both countries to map the resource potential up to, and along, the delimitation line,” he added.
